A sweet potato usually shows a progression from fresh to dehydrated to genuinely decayed. The useful distinction is between simple aging—such as mild wrinkling—and wet, soft, moldy or foul-smelling tissue.
Wet soft spots are a strong warning sign
A sound sweet potato should feel firm. Sunken areas that yield easily, watery tissue, leaking liquid or flesh that collapses are more concerning than a few dry surface scuffs.
Mechanical injury creates entry points for decay organisms. UC Davis notes that handling damage and chilling injury predispose sweet potatoes to fungal decay, including Rhizopus soft rot.
Visible mold changes the decision
Cottony, green, black or white fungal growth together with soft or decaying tissue is a reason to discard the sweet potato rather than simply carve away the visible patch.
Fungal growth can extend beyond the part you can see.
Odor becomes useful once decay is advanced
Fresh sweet potatoes have very little smell. A distinctly fermented, sour, alcoholic or rotten odor, especially together with softening or liquid, strongly suggests deterioration.
Wrinkling alone is often moisture loss
Skin wrinkles as the root loses water. If the interior is still firm and there is no mold, leaking fluid or abnormal odor, the issue may mainly be lower eating quality.
A severely shriveled, rubbery, lightweight sweet potato is unlikely to cook well even without obvious rot.
Cold damage can cause internal browning
Sweet potatoes are chilling-sensitive. UC Davis lists internal flesh browning, shriveling and increased fungal decay among chilling-injury symptoms. A brown patch inside can therefore have more than one cause; judge it together with texture, odor and how extensive the damage is.
Storage history helps interpret borderline sweet potatoes. A root that has slowly become a little wrinkled in a dry pantry may simply have lost moisture, while one that turns soft and wet over a short period is more suggestive of active decay. Looking at texture, odor and the condition of the flesh together gives a better answer than focusing on skin color alone.
Cut the sweet potato if the outside leaves you uncertain. Healthy flesh should be firm for the variety and have a normal color and smell. A small dry bruise can often be trimmed away during preparation, but extensive dark, wet or mushy tissue is a different situation. If decay penetrates deeply, discarding the root is more sensible than trying to rescue a narrow clean-looking section.
Sprouting and shriveling are primarily quality signals. They show that the stored root is aging and using its reserves, so texture and flavor may deteriorate. Mold, leaking liquid and soft rot deserve more weight because they indicate decomposition rather than simple physiological aging.
Temperature matters as well. Sweet potatoes prefer warmer storage than a household refrigerator, and chilling can injure the tissue. Internal discoloration after poor storage can therefore have more than one cause. That is another reason not to diagnose spoilage from a single brown patch without considering firmness, moisture and smell.
For routine storage, keep sound sweet potatoes dry, ventilated and away from obvious heat sources. Inspect the group occasionally and remove any root that begins leaking or molding so it does not remain pressed against the others.
When several sweet potatoes are stored together, one deteriorating root can create a damp local environment and stain its neighbors. Separating damaged pieces early is therefore useful even if the rest of the batch is sound. Avoid washing whole sweet potatoes before long pantry storage because residual moisture can encourage decay; wash them when you are ready to cook. Once cut, the situation changes: exposed flesh should be refrigerated and used promptly rather than returned to long room-temperature storage. Keeping the distinction between whole-root storage and cut-food storage prevents advice meant for an intact sweet potato from being applied to a peeled or sliced one.
A normal earthy or sweet aroma differs from a sour, fermented or putrid odor. Smell should be combined with texture and visible condition rather than used as the only test, especially when the root has already become wet or moldy.
The practical rule
Firm with mild wrinkles: likely a quality issue. Wet-soft, moldy, leaking, foul-smelling or extensively decayed: discard it. If a cut root shows deep damage and you cannot clearly separate sound flesh from decayed tissue, it is not worth trying to salvage.
